Hi. Frequent colds are common in children. 6 to 8 colds per year is usual. Children start speaking 2 to 3 words by 1 yr, 10 to 15 words by 1.5 yr and 2 word sentences by 2 yrs. So your child has a definite delay in speech. So needs evaluation including hearing test. Chewing thumb is not the reason for speech delay. Also Child needs to be taught rigorously at home how to speak by parents, grand parents etc. Can put him in play school as he will interact with other children and may learn fast. Speech delay is more common in small families where children has less opportunity to learn
